Over the weekend, prime candidate for most badass wrestler - man - on the planet, Minoru Suzuki, celebrated his pro wrestling 30th anniversary, days after his 50th birthday, by doing a very Minoru Suzuki thing. He fought the best wrestler on the planet, Kazuchika Okada, in a 30-minute draw. In the pouring rain. And, afterwards, he cleaned up everybody's litter and demanded they did the same.

Wrestling Minoru Suzuki is a terrifying proposition in itself. The notion of slipping into his sadistic, catch submission game must have added an even more frightening element for those fans he allowed free entry (!) into his two-day "Great Pirate" (!) festival as, all the while, purely for the banter, he dyed his hair white and wore white trunks. If Suzuki wasn't already the absolute best, he took the microphone and perfected the role of motivational speaker by encouraging his young public to make their mark on the world by working hard. Brilliantly, he also b*llocked the "dispirited middle-aged guys" in the crowd because the world isn't going to "cut them a break".

An environmentalist, motivational speaker, philanthropist, absolute warlord: Minoru Suzuki is the best man alive.

As for the match itself, sadly, only photographs were recorded. But gauging by the milky, opaque liquid lashed all over Okada's face, we should see an at least ***** rating in next week's Observer.
